The Alpine Express is a fictional book written by Cesar Faison under his pen name "P.K. Sinclair". A storyline on General Hospital involved Faison writing a book called The Alpine Express. Davnee, an anagram for Anna Devane, was the name of the heroine in Sinclair's book and another book called "The Crystalline Conspiracy". The events in both books were based on the activities of Anna and Cesar's spy days.
